Pitali ste: Kako koristite Uniq komandu u Unixu?

How use uniq command in Linux?

Uniq komanda može prebrojati i ispisati broj redova koji se ponavljaju. Baš kao i duple linije, možemo filtrirati i jedinstvene linije (ne-duplicirane linije), a također možemo zanemariti osjetljivost na velika i mala slova. Možemo preskočiti polja i znakove prije nego uporedimo duple linije i također razmotriti znakove za filtriranje linija.

What does uniq command do in Unix?

The uniq command in Linux is a command line utility that reports or filters out the repeated lines in a file. In simple words, uniq is the tool that helps to detect the adjacent duplicate lines and also deletes the duplicate lines.

Kako da pronađem jedinstvene zapise u Unixu?

Kako pronaći duple zapise datoteke u Linuxu?

  1. Korištenje sort i uniq: $ sort file | uniq -d Linux. …
  2. awk način dohvaćanja duplikata: $ awk '{a[$0]++}END{for (i in a)if (a[i]>1)print i;}' fajl Linux. …
  3. Koristeći perl način: …
  4. Još jedan perl način: …
  5. Shell skripta za dohvaćanje/pronalaženje duplikata zapisa:

What is uniq in bash?

uniq command is used to detect the adjacent lines from a file and write the content of the file by filtering the duplicate values or write only the duplicate lines into another file. …

Kako da koristim grep?

Naredba grep pretražuje datoteku, tražeći podudaranja sa specificiranim uzorkom. Da biste ga koristili, upišite grep obrazac koji tražimo i konačno naziv datoteke (ili datoteka) u kojoj pretražujemo. Izlaz su tri reda u datoteci koji sadrže slova 'ne'.

Šta du command radi u Linuxu?

Naredba du je standardna Linux/Unix naredba koja omogućava korisniku da brzo dobije informacije o korištenju diska. Najbolje se primjenjuje na određene direktorije i omogućava mnoge varijacije za prilagođavanje izlaza kako bi zadovoljio vaše potrebe.

Kako koristite naredbu sortiranje?

Naredba SORT se koristi za sortiranje datoteke, sređivanje ploče određenim redosledom. Podrazumevano, naredba sort sortira datoteku pod pretpostavkom da je sadržaj ASCII. Koristeći opcije u naredbi sortiranja, može se koristiti i za numeričko sortiranje. Naredba SORT sortira sadržaj tekstualne datoteke, red po red.

Ko koristi Linux?

wc označava broj riječi. Kao što naziv govori, uglavnom se koristi u svrhu brojanja. Koristi se za pronalaženje broja redova, broja riječi, broja bajtova i znakova u datotekama navedenim u argumentima datoteke.

Šta je tr u shell skripti?

Komanda tr u UNIX-u je uslužni program komandne linije za prevođenje ili brisanje znakova. Podržava niz transformacija uključujući velika u mala slova, stiskanje ponavljajućih znakova, brisanje određenih znakova i osnovno pronalaženje i zamjenu. Može se koristiti sa UNIX cijevima za podršku složenijih prijevoda.

Šta je awk Unix naredba?

Awk je skriptni jezik koji se koristi za manipulaciju podacima i generiranje izvještaja. Programski jezik naredbi awk ne zahtijeva kompajliranje i dozvoljava korisniku da koristi varijable, numeričke funkcije, nizove funkcije i logičke operatore. … Awk se uglavnom koristi za skeniranje i obradu uzoraka.

Kako pronaći ponovljene riječi u Linuxu?

objašnjenje

  1. Prvo možete tokenizirati riječi sa grep -wo , svaka riječ se ispisuje u jednini.
  2. Zatim možete sortirati tokenizirane riječi pomoću sort .
  3. Konačno može pronaći uzastopne jedinstvene ili duplirane riječi sa uniq . 3.1. uniq -c Ovo ispisuje riječi i njihov broj.

Kako da dobijem jedinstvene linije u datoteci?

Pronađite jedinstvene linije

  1. Datoteka se prvo mora sortirati. sortiraj fajl | uniq -u će izaći na konzolu za vas. – ma77c. …
  2. Mislim da je razlog sortiranja fajla | uniq pokazuje sve vrijednosti 1 put je zato što odmah ispisuje red na koji naiđe prvi put, a za naredne susrete samo ih preskače. – Reeshabh Ranjan.

How do I sort uniq in Linux?

The Linux utilities sort and uniq are useful for ordering and manipulating data in text files and as part of shell scripting. The sort command takes a list of items and sorts them alphabetically and numerically. The uniq command takes a list of items and removes adjacent duplicate lines.

Kako da sortiram i uklonim duplikate u Linuxu?

Morate koristiti shell cijevi zajedno sa sljedeća dva uslužna programa Linux komandne linije za sortiranje i uklanjanje duplikata teksta:

  1. naredba sort - Sortiraj redove tekstualnih datoteka u Linux i Unix sistemima.
  2. uniq naredba – Rport ili izostavljanje ponovljenih redova na Linuxu ili Unixu.

Kako da dobijem jedinstvene linije u Linuxu?

Da biste pronašli jedinstvena pojavljivanja gdje linije nisu susjedne, datoteka mora biti sortirano prije prolaska u uniq . uniq će raditi kako se očekuje na sljedećoj datoteci koja je imenovana autori. poruka . Kako su duplikati susjedni, uniq će vratiti jedinstvena pojavljivanja i poslati rezultat na standardni izlaz.

Sviđa vam se ovaj post? Molimo vas da podijelite sa svojim prijateljima:
OS Today